INTERNATIONAL RY. CO. v. PRENDERGAST


1 F.Supp. 623 (1932)

INTERNATIONAL RY. CO. v. PRENDERGAST et al.

District Court, W. D. New York.

October 11, 1932.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Henry W. Killeen and James C. Sweeney, both of Buffalo, N. Y., and Coleman J. Joyce, of Philadelphia, Pa., for plaintiff.

Charles G. Blakeslee, of Albany, N. Y. (Russell B. Burnside, of Albany, N. Y., and George E. McVay, of Huguenot Park, S. I., N. Y., of counsel), for defendant Public Service Commission.

Charles L. Feldman, Corp. Counsel, of Buffalo, N. Y. (Frank C. Laughlin, of New York City, and Frederic C. Rupp, Jeremiah J. Hurley, and Fred C. Maloney, all of Buffalo, N. Y., of counsel), for defendant City of Buffalo.

Before MANTON, Circuit Judge, and ADLER and KNIGHT, District Judges, constituting a statutory court, convened pursuant to section 266 of the Judicial Code, as amended (28 USCA § 380).


MANTON, Circuit Judge.

The plaintiff moves for a confirmation of the master's report in this suit seeking relief from a claimed confiscation of its street railway property by reason of the rate of fare it is permitted to charge for carrying passengers in the city of Buffalo.
